Healthgrades recognized Christiana Care Health System as one of “America’s 100 Best Hospitals” in 2018.
The ranking places the system in the top two percent of nearly 5,000 hospitals nationwide. Healthgrades makes the rankings based on year-over-year clinical performance.

Some of the particular metrics include risk-adjusted mortality and in-hospital complications.
Christiana Care received the following distinctions in 2018:
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Orthopedic Surgery™ for 5 Years in a Row (2014-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Joint Replacement™ for 3 Years in a Row (2016-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Spine Surgery™ for 5 Years in a Row (2014-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Stroke Care™ for 3 Years in a Row (2016-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Pulmonary Care™ for 3 Years in a Row (2016-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for Gastrointestinal Care™ for 7 Years in a Row (2012-2018)
· One of Healthgrades America's 100 Best Hospitals for General Surgery™ for 7 Years in a Row (2012-2018)
